#711959 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#711959 is composed of 44.3% red, 9.8% green and 34.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 77.9% magenta, 21.2% yellow and 55.7% black. It has a hue angle of 316.4 degrees, a saturation of 63.8% and a lightness of 27.1%. #711959 color hex could be obtained by blending #e232b2 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660066.

Shades and Tints of #711959

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010000 is the darkest color, while #fcf0f8 is the lightest one.
